Support 'The Coosie' being redeveloped into a Community Sports Hub by Tullibody St. Serf's

The Issue
'The Coosie' has lain unused for years, since pre-pandemic times, despite Clackmannanshire Council still referring to it as a football pitch. We want to change that.
There is a distinct lack of bookable all-weather pitches available in the Wee County. Locally, only Lornshill Academy offers such a facility - our plans involve the installation of a FIFA-grade astroturf surface, proper changing facilities on site, storage containers and a short boundary fence to protect the new pitch. There is potential to add small spectator stands and other community useable indoor spaces as time goes on.
Having lodged an application for Community Asset Transfer, Tullibody St. Serf's Football Club intend to take over running of 'The Coosie' and build up a local sports hub facility open to all in Tullibody & surrounding areas.
